Comedy Night: A Festival favourite with 4 superb comedians
Enjoy an evening of top-class, multi-award-winning stand-up comedy with a late bar. The proceeds from the raffle will be in aid of a local charity. The lineup for this year’s event is:
- Allyson Smith: her genuine and unique sense of humor, combined with excellent performance timing makes audiences laugh. This teacher-come-comic is ready to show international audiences why she is a sought-after fan favourite. Allyson is a multiple Canadian Comedy Award nominee for Best Female Stand-Up.
- Katie Mulgrew: multi-talented, award-winning writer, actor and stand-up, she has featured on BBC Radio 4, BBC Radio 2 and CBBC and ITV2. Katie is the daughter of legendary Irish funnyman Jimmy Cricket,
- Mike Newall: laid-back with well-crafted jokes and a wonderful dry delivery. Observational comedy at its best, razor sharp timing and a keen sense of dark sarcasm. He appeared on Britain’s Got Talent where he impressed the judges so much that Simon Cowell said, “it was like an Oasis concert where the music ran out and Liam decides to tell a few jokes!” He’s appeared several timea at the Edinburgh Fringe and is described as ‘your best, most humorous friend – only funnier!
- Ria Lina: Award-winning comedian. Doctor of Virology. Ria is also host of news commentary podcast “Ria Lina’s Behind”. She had appeared on BBC/Comedy Central/Sky News. Fearless, provocative, and very funny, Ria s a highly accomplished comedian, writer and actor.
